Sod Suppliers in Sanford, Florida

Showing 3 Sod Suppliers

A C & L Farms

(407) 323-8331

107 Palm Terrace

Sanford, Florida

Bob's Sod Service

(407) 864-8318

4120 Moores Station Rd

Sanford, Florida

Sod Express Nursery

(407) 331-1155

3775 N US Hwy 17 92

Sanford, Florida